Preparing Source Data for Pivot Tables

๐Ÿ“‹ Use a Flat Tabular Layout

Every column needs a clear header in row 1, every row needs to represent one observation, and there should be no merged cells, subtotals, or blank rows breaking up the dataset before you insert your pivot.

๐Ÿงฑ Convert to an Excel Table

Press Ctrl+T to convert your range into a structured Excel Table. This ensures new rows added to the bottom are automatically included in your pivot when you refresh, eliminating the need to manually expand source ranges later.

๐Ÿงน Clean Mixed Data Types

Numbers stored as text will refuse to sum and dates stored as text will not group properly. Use the VALUE function or Text to Columns to standardize types before building the pivot to avoid frustrating aggregation errors.

๐Ÿ”„ Remove Duplicates First

Before pivoting, run Data > Remove Duplicates on any key columns where duplicates would distort counts. This is especially important when summarizing distinct customers, transactions, or unique order IDs across the dataset.

๐Ÿท๏ธ Name Your Range or Table

Give your Excel Table a meaningful name like tblSales2026 in the Table Design tab. Named tables make pivot refresh, formulas, and source switching dramatically easier when you scale to multiple sheets.

Building your first pivot table takes less than a minute once your source data is clean. Click anywhere inside your data range, go to the Insert tab on the ribbon, and choose PivotTable. Excel detects the surrounding data automatically and prompts you to place the pivot on a new worksheet, which is the recommended default because it keeps the source and the analysis cleanly separated. Confirm the dialog, and an empty pivot frame appears with the PivotTable Fields pane docked on the right side of your screen.

The Fields pane is where the magic happens. It shows every column header from your source as a draggable field. Below the field list are four drop zones: Filters, Columns, Rows, and Values. Drag Region into Rows, Month into Columns, and Sales into Values. Excel instantly summarizes total sales by region across months. The default aggregation for numeric fields is SUM, but you can right-click any value cell and choose Summarize Values By to switch to Average, Count, Max, Min, Product, or several statistical options.

Pivot table layouts come in three flavors: Compact (default), Outline, and Tabular. Compact stacks all row fields into a single column to save horizontal space, which is fine for quick exploration. Tabular gives each row field its own column and shows item labels in every row, which is essential when you want to copy the pivot output into another workbook or feed it into another formula. Switch layouts under Design > Report Layout depending on your downstream use case.

Sorting and filtering inside a pivot is more powerful than in a regular range. Click the dropdown arrow on any row or column label to sort A to Z, sort by value, or apply label filters like "contains," "begins with," or "greater than." Value filters let you keep only the top 10 products by revenue or the bottom 5 regions by margin, which is incredibly useful for executive summaries. These filters persist when you refresh and recompute automatically when source data changes.

Number formatting is set on the pivot itself, not the source. Right-click any value cell, choose Number Format, and pick currency, percentage, or thousands separator. This is critical because pivot tables strip standard cell formatting from your source range. Setting it once on the value field applies it consistently across all current and future cells in that field, even after refreshes that introduce new rows or columns to the layout.

Grouping is one of the most underused pivot features. Right-click any date field in the Rows area and choose Group. You can roll up daily dates into months, quarters, or years with a single click. Numeric fields can be grouped into ranges, like age buckets of 10 years or revenue tiers of 5,000. Grouping creates virtual fields you can then drag into other areas, letting you build cohort analyses without ever modifying the underlying data source.

Filtering Pivots with Slicers and Timelines

๐Ÿ“‹ Slicers

Slicers are visual filter buttons that sit alongside your pivot table and let users click to filter without opening any dropdown menus. To add one, click inside the pivot, go to PivotTable Analyze, and choose Insert Slicer. Pick the fields you want to expose as filters, such as Region, Product Category, or Salesperson, and Excel drops floating button panels onto the sheet that you can resize and style.

Slicers shine in dashboards because they provide instant visual feedback about which filters are active. Highlighted buttons indicate selected items, dimmed buttons show items with no data under current filters, and the multi-select toggle lets users combine selections quickly. One slicer can also control multiple pivot tables simultaneously via the Report Connections dialog, which is the key to building synchronized executive dashboards from a single shared data source.

๐Ÿ“‹ Timelines

Timelines are specialized slicers built exclusively for date fields. Insert one from PivotTable Analyze > Insert Timeline and choose your date column. The timeline displays a horizontal scrollbar grouped by years, quarters, months, or days, and users can drag handles to define custom date ranges. This is far more intuitive than typing dates into label filters and works beautifully for monthly reporting cycles or rolling-window analyses.

Timelines require your date column to be true Excel dates, not text that looks like dates. If the Insert Timeline option is grayed out, the source field is being read as text. Fix it with Text to Columns set to Date format, or use the DATEVALUE function to convert. Once dates are real, timelines unlock smooth period-over-period comparisons that would otherwise require complex DAX or array formulas in regular ranges.

๐Ÿ“‹ Report Filters

The Filters drop zone at the top of the PivotTable Fields pane creates a classic page-level filter dropdown above the pivot. Drag a field there and a single-cell dropdown appears that lets users restrict the entire pivot to one or more selected values. This is useful when you want a compact filter that does not consume visual real estate the way a slicer panel does on dashboards.

A powerful trick with report filters is the Show Report Filter Pages feature found in PivotTable Analyze > Options. It generates a separate worksheet for each unique value in the filter field, replicating the pivot per region, per salesperson, or per product line. This is the fastest way to produce individualized reports for stakeholders without manually copying and reconfiguring pivots, and the resulting sheets refresh together when you refresh the master pivot.

Pivot Table Best Practices Checklist

Convert source data to an Excel Table with Ctrl+T before pivoting
Verify every column has a unique, descriptive header in row 1
Remove all blank rows and merged cells from the source range
Confirm date columns store true dates, not text strings
Standardize numeric columns so none are stored as text
Place pivot output on a separate worksheet from the source
Apply number formatting on the pivot value field, not source cells
Use slicers or timelines for any dashboard intended for end users
Set refresh on open under PivotTable Options for live reports
Document calculated fields and items in a notes cell beside the pivot
Limit very large source ranges with Power Pivot data models
Save a clean baseline layout copy before letting users explore filters
Always set refresh-on-open for live operational reports

Right-click any pivot, choose PivotTable Options, go to the Data tab, and tick "Refresh data when opening the file." This single setting prevents the most common stakeholder complaint: a pivot displaying stale numbers because nobody clicked Refresh. For workbooks with multiple pivots sharing one source, all of them refresh in sync when the workbook opens.

Calculated fields let you create new metrics inside a pivot table without modifying the source data. Go to PivotTable Analyze > Fields, Items, & Sets > Calculated Field. Give it a name like Profit Margin, then enter a formula referencing existing field names, such as =Profit/Sales. Excel adds the new field to the Fields pane, and you can drag it into Values just like any other column. The calculation runs at the aggregation level, so it operates on summed values, not row-by-row source data.

This aggregation behavior is critical to understand. If you create a calculated field =Price*Quantity, Excel will multiply the SUM of Price by the SUM of Quantity, which is almost never what you want. The correct approach is to compute Revenue in the source data (Price*Quantity per row) and then sum Revenue in the pivot. Calculated fields work best for ratios and differences between already-summed values, like margin percent, growth rate, or variance from budget.

Calculated items are different and more advanced. They create new rows or columns within an existing field. For example, if your Region field contains North, South, East, and West, you could create a calculated item called "Coast" that sums North and South. This is powerful but disables several pivot features like grouping and Show Values As, so use it sparingly and only when reshaping the source data is not feasible for your situation.

The Show Values As feature is the unsung hero of pivot calculations. Right-click any value cell, choose Show Values As, and you get a menu of percentage of total, percentage of row, percentage of column, percentage of parent, running total, rank, and difference from another value. These transformations require zero formula writing and recompute automatically when filters change, making them perfect for executive dashboards that need percentage breakdowns alongside raw numbers in the same view.

GETPIVOTDATA is a function Excel auto-generates when you click a pivot cell from outside the pivot. It returns the exact aggregated value regardless of pivot layout changes, which protects your downstream formulas from breaking when users drag fields around. Many analysts hate it and turn it off via PivotTable Analyze > Options > Generate GetPivotData, but in production reports it is actually safer than simple cell references because it survives layout reshuffles.

Power Pivot extends regular pivot tables with a true data model that supports relationships between multiple tables, DAX formulas, and datasets exceeding Excel's 1,048,576 row limit. Enable it via File > Options > Add-ins > COM Add-ins. Once active, the Manage Data Model button lets you import tables from SQL, Access, or other workbooks and build star-schema relationships. The resulting pivots feel identical to regular pivots but pull from a vastly more powerful engine underneath the surface.

Pivot charts pair naturally with pivot tables to turn aggregated numbers into visual stories. Click inside any pivot, go to PivotTable Analyze, and choose PivotChart. The chart inherits the pivot's filters, slicers, and field layout, and any change you make to the pivot reflects instantly in the chart. Stacked bars work beautifully for region-by-product breakdowns, line charts for monthly trends, and clustered columns for year-over-year comparisons across categories or business units.

Conditional formatting works inside pivots and is one of the fastest ways to add visual impact. Select the value cells, go to Home > Conditional Formatting, and apply color scales, data bars, or icon sets. The smart formatting options at the bottom of the menu let you apply the rule to all cells showing the same value field, so new rows added on refresh inherit the formatting automatically without manual reapplication every time the dataset grows.

Sorting pivots by custom orders sometimes trips beginners up. By default, row labels sort alphabetically or by underlying data values. To enforce a custom order like a fiscal calendar that starts in July, use File > Options > Advanced > Edit Custom Lists to define your sequence, then sort the pivot row field by that custom list. This applies persistently and survives refreshes, ensuring your reports always present categories in the order stakeholders expect.

Common errors include #REF! after deleting source columns, #DIV/0! in calculated fields with zero denominators, and "PivotTable field name is not valid" when a header is blank or duplicated. For #DIV/0!, wrap the calculated field in IFERROR. For #REF!, check that all referenced columns still exist in the source. For invalid field names, ensure row 1 has unique, non-blank labels and refresh the pivot after fixing them in the source range.

Performance optimization matters once your source approaches 100,000 rows. Disable automatic refresh during heavy edits, keep slicer counts low on shared dashboards, and avoid stacking many calculated fields on the same pivot. If performance still lags, move to a Power Pivot data model where columnar compression and the xVelocity engine handle millions of rows with sub-second response times even on modest laptop hardware running modern versions of Excel for Microsoft 365.

Refresh behavior deserves attention in collaborative workbooks. Multiple users editing the same workbook in OneDrive or SharePoint can trigger refresh conflicts. Set the refresh order explicitly under PivotTable Analyze > Refresh > Connection Properties, and consider scheduling refreshes via Power Automate for workbooks that pull from external sources. This prevents the awkward situation where one user's local refresh overwrites another's filter selections in shared dashboards used by distributed teams.

Keyboard shortcuts dramatically accelerate pivot work. Alt+N+V opens the Insert PivotTable dialog. Alt+JT+F+I inserts a slicer when your cursor is in a pivot. F5 with a named range jumps you to your source data instantly. Ctrl+Shift+L toggles AutoFilter on the source for quick pre-pivot exploration. Memorizing even five of these shortcuts can shave 20 minutes off a typical analyst workday and removes the friction of constant mouse navigation through the ribbon.

What is a pivot table in Excel?

A pivot table is an interactive data summarization tool that takes a flat list of records and reshapes it into a configurable matrix of rows, columns, filters, and aggregated values. You drag field names from your source data into drop zones, and Excel automatically calculates sums, averages, counts, or other summary statistics. The table rebuilds itself instantly when you change filters or rearrange fields, making analysis fast and flexible.

How do I refresh a pivot table?

Click anywhere inside the pivot, go to PivotTable Analyze on the ribbon, and click Refresh. To refresh all pivots in the workbook at once, use Refresh All instead. The keyboard shortcut Alt+F5 refreshes the active pivot, and Ctrl+Alt+F5 refreshes every pivot and data connection in the file. You can also set automatic refresh on open through PivotTable Options.

Why is my pivot table showing blank rows?

Blank rows in pivot results usually mean your source data contains empty cells in the field you are summarizing, or the source range extends beyond your actual data. Convert your source to an Excel Table with Ctrl+T to lock the range to real data only. You can also filter the row field to exclude (blank) entries, or fill empty source cells with zero or a placeholder value first.

Can I use a pivot table on multiple sheets?

Yes, but the cleanest method is to consolidate the sheets into one table using Power Query first, then build the pivot on the combined output. Excel also offers the Multiple Consolidation Ranges option from the PivotTable wizard, but it has limited layout flexibility. For relational data across sheets, enable Power Pivot and build a data model with relationships between the tables for full pivot functionality.

How do I add a calculated field to a pivot?

Click inside the pivot, go to PivotTable Analyze, then Fields, Items, & Sets, and choose Calculated Field. Name the field and enter a formula using existing field names, such as =Profit/Sales. The calculation runs on aggregated values, not row-by-row, so it works best for ratios and differences between already-summed fields rather than per-row calculations that should live in the source data.

What is the difference between a pivot table and a regular table?

A regular Excel Table is a structured range with filtering and sorting that displays raw data row by row. A pivot table summarizes that raw data by grouping it across chosen dimensions and aggregating numeric values. Tables show every record; pivots show summaries. You typically build a pivot from a Table because Tables automatically expand the pivot source as new rows are added to the underlying dataset.

How do I group dates in a pivot table?

Right-click any date in the Rows area of the pivot and choose Group. The dialog lets you select Days, Months, Quarters, Years, or combinations like Months and Years together. Excel creates virtual grouping fields you can rearrange independently. If grouping is grayed out, your date column contains text strings instead of true dates, which you can fix with Text to Columns set to Date format.

Can I create a pivot chart without a pivot table?

No, pivot charts always require an underlying pivot table to source their data. However, when you click Insert PivotChart from a raw data range, Excel creates both the pivot table and the chart simultaneously in one action. You can hide the pivot table on a separate sheet if you want only the chart visible, but the pivot must exist somewhere in the workbook for the chart to function.

How do I remove duplicates before building a pivot?

Select your data range, go to the Data tab, and click Remove Duplicates. Check the columns that define uniqueness, such as Order ID alone or Customer plus Date combined. Excel keeps the first occurrence of each unique combination and deletes the rest. Always work on a copy of your data first because the operation is destructive and cannot be undone after you save and close the workbook.

What is GETPIVOTDATA and should I use it?

GETPIVOTDATA is a function Excel auto-generates when you reference a pivot cell from outside the pivot. It returns the aggregated value regardless of layout changes, making it more robust than direct cell references that break when fields are rearranged. Many analysts disable it for convenience, but in production dashboards it actually protects downstream formulas from breaking when stakeholders interact with slicers, filters, or pivot layout adjustments.
